iconPCR™
World’s First Real-time Thermocycler with 96 individually controlled wells
Overview

The iconPCR™ by n6 is the world’s first individually controlled, plate-based thermocycling technology — a breakthrough in DNA amplification and next-generation sequencing (NGS) workflows.

Featuring 96 distinct thermocycling elements, iconPCR offers unmatched flexibility and precision for a wide range of genomic applications. It enables unique sample preparation capabilities without compromising the high-throughput format essential for modern laboratory workflows.

The iconPCR system is a compact benchtop instrument designed to operate as a stand-alone platform or be seamlessly integrated into automation systems, all while using standard reagents and consumables.

96 independently programmable thermal zones
Each of the 96 wells is a fully isolated thermal zone, allowing exact protocol matching per sample—regardless of input amount or assay type.
Real-Time Feedback Per Well
Real-time fluorescence detection in each independently controlled well enables live monitoring of amplification curves. This feedback powers in-run decision-making, not just post-run analysis.
AutoNorm™
IconPCR dynamically adjusts cycle numbers per well to normalize output concentrations across all samples—without manual input, added reagents, or downstream correction steps
iconPCR Workflow:
  1. Prepare pre-PCR reaction mix using your standard reagents plus an intercalator of your choice
  2. Load samples into a standard 96-well optical plate and seal
  3. Select a protocol and start the run
  4. IconPCR monitors amplification in real time and automatically adjusts cycles per well
  5. Remove plate—libraries are normalized and ready to pool or proceed to cleanup
